Saddle of Suckling Lamb in Kadaïf, Lemon Condiment Recipe
Ingredients:
- 1 saddle of suckling lamb
- 200 grams kadaïf pastry
- 200 milliliters olive oil
- 1 lemon
- 2 egg yolks
- 2 cloves of garlic
- 1 bunch of parsley
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- Preheat the oven to 180°C.
- Make the lemon condiment: finely grate the zest of the lemon and squeeze the juice into a bowl. Add the egg yolks, garlic cloves (finely chopped), and chopped parsley, then whisk together until smooth. Slowly add the olive oil while whisking until you get a creamy sauce.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Season the saddle of lamb with salt and pepper and brown it in a hot pan with a little olive oil for 2-3 minutes on each side.
- Place the kadaïf pastry in the center of a baking tray and put the saddle of lamb on top of it.
- Cover the saddle of lamb with the kadaïf pastry, making sure it is completely covered. Drizzle some olive oil over the pastry.
- Bake in the oven for 20-25 minutes, or until the pastry is golden brown and the lamb is cooked to your liking.
- Remove from the oven and let it rest for at least 5 minutes before slicing it into portions.
- Serve with the lemon condiment on the side.
